KIDS SKI FREE AT BRIGHTON

Up to Two Kids Ages 6 & Under Ski Free Per Paying Adult

A Family Sport. Brighton Resort is well-known as the place where Utah learns to ski and ride. Start your kids out on the slopes early with two free 6 & under tickets per paying adult.

Who is Eligible? 

One paying or Season Pass/Go Card holding adult can claim up to two tickets for children 6 & under. 

How to Redeem Your Tickets

Adults may pick up the tickets at the outdoor ticket windows at the base of the Brighton Center. If you have purchased adult lift tickets online, you may present the QR code in your confirmation email in order to redeem your free tickets. Please have the children present so cashiers can verify age.

One-Time $5 Media Fee 

There is a one-time $5 media fee to cover the cost of the reloadable cardstock. Please keep the tickets and bring them back to the ticket window the next time you wish to claim free 6 & under tickets. Cashiers can reload the existing cardstock and you can avoid an additional $5 fee.
